Electronic passport with security features from Veridos wins “Regional ID Document of the Year Award”​

Berlin, 28 March 2024 – Latvia’s new electronic passport has won the “Regional ID Document of the Year Award” at the High Security Printing (HSP) EMEA 2024 industry conference. The award-winning passport is equipped with innovative security features from Veridos and contains a color photo as primary image of the passport holder.

Each year, the HSP Conference honors programs for personal identification and travel documents with the “Regional ID Document of the Year Award“. These programs demonstrate outstanding achievements and technical sophistication. With this award, the HSP industry recognizes the best system infrastructures and the best implementations of a government passport, ID and other secure identification systems.

Latvia’s new electronic passport received the coveted “Best New Passport” award at the HSP-EMEA conference held in the Bulgarian capital, Sofia, in March. The next-generation ePassport is produced by Veridos, the world’s leading provider of secure identity solutions, in consortium with the Portuguese state printer INCM, and is equipped with Veridos’ innovative security features CLIP ID Echo, Amber ID, Diamond ID and Spectre ID.

CLIP ID Echo is an evolution of CLIP ID, a technology for color personalization on polycarbonate data pages, and enables a vivid color photo as primary image of the passport holder on the new Latvian ePassports. The passport features repeating personalized data such as the name and date of birth in the background, which are only visible from certain angles. Amber ID, Diamond ID and Spectre ID combine transparent window and stripe elements with unique materials, personalized data and special effects. These four features bring a new level of security to ePassports, ensuring secure and convenient travel for their holders. By using Veridos’ visible and advanced UV printing capabilities, the passports also have a very complex and unique design with individual motifs on every visa page reflecting Latvia’s rich nature.

Veridos

Veridos is a leading global provider of integrated identity solutions. Governments and public authorities in more than 100 countries rely on the company’s unique, comprehensive product portfolio. Veridos offers complete solutions and comprehensive services that are perfectly tailored to each customer’s identification requirements. The offerings range from paper to security printing and electrochip components, data capture, identity management systems, and personalization and issuance of ID documents to mobile ID and border control solutions, including eGates. The company offers the highest quality identity documents, including passports, ID cards and driver’s licenses, and even the production facilities to enable governments to produce them themselves.
